Count Expected Loss

Figure out your hourly loss this way:

Average bet × Turns × House edge = Loss per hour

Check Expected Loss Rates

gaming risk assessment strategy

The house edge rate predicts player losses over time. With a 5% house edge, you should expect to lose $5 for every $100 bet across many plays.

Familiar games have these edge rates:

  • American Roulette: 5.26% house edge
  • Blackjack with Basic Plan: 0.5% house edge
  • Slots: 2-15% house edge
  • Baccarat: 1.06% house edge (banker bet)

Real Odds vs Paid Rates

Casino profits stem from the gap between real odds and what’s paid out.

Consider these cases:

  • Roulette Straight-Up Bet:
  • Paid Rates: 35:1
  • Real Rates (American): 37:1
  • Real Rates (European): 36:1

This difference creates the math profit for casinos.

The house edge strategy works by paying less than the real odds, boosting casino profits while keeping players engaged.
